Section 25-4-117

Representation in court actions.

The director and the state, in any court action relating to this chapter or its administration and enforcement, shall be represented by any qualified attorney regularly employed by the Department of Industrial Relations, and who is designated by the director for such purpose; provided, however, that the director may request the Attorney General or such special counsel as he deems necessary to represent him in any such action.

(Acts 1939, No. 497, p. 721; Code 1940, T. 26, §234.)
